Abstract
The concept of sustainability has been widely implemented in various organizations. This research
aims to develop a theory of implementing the concept of sustainability in non-business organizations,
namely, institutes of higher education of Indonesia. The methods used in this research are literature
review and content analysis of reports of universities that have implemented the concept of sustainability
within their organizations. This research consists of two main parts in which the first part focuses on
drafting concepts for implementing sustainability in higher education institutions, and the second part
discusses ways to establish a sustainable university. The results of this research will aid in compiling and
developing our motive. The resulting concept will consist of three main stages and it can be used as a
guideline for universities that will implement the concept of sustainability. This research will frame the
policy that can be applied to form a sustainable university and identify obstacles and challenges for the
same.
